Overview:

Freelance hairstylists are independent professionals who provide hair styling services to clients on a contractual basis. They typically work in salons, spas, and other beauty establishments, but may also work from home or travel to clients’ homes. Freelance hairstylists must be knowledgeable about the latest trends in hair styling and be able to create a variety of looks for their clients. They must also be able to work with a variety of hair types and textures.

How To Become an Freelance Hairstylist:

To become a freelance hairstylist, you must first complete a cosmetology program at a state-approved school. After completing the program, you must obtain a license from your state’s cosmetology board. Once you have your license, you can start working as a freelance hairstylist.
